Black and white footage from the dedication ceremony of the Van Den Nestlei Synagogue in Antwerp, Belgium.
The synagogue of the Shomrei Hadas Congregation, originally built in 1929, was damaged in World War II, and the structure was renovated thanks to the donation of Romi Goldmuntz, after whom the renovated synagogue was named.
